Backup and DR Service v1 API - Class BackupConfigInfo (1.2.0)

public sealed class BackupConfigInfo : IMessage<BackupConfigInfo>, IEquatable<BackupConfigInfo>, IDeepCloneable<BackupConfigInfo>, IBufferMessage, IMessage

Reference documentation and code samples for the Backup and DR Service v1 API class BackupConfigInfo.

BackupConfigInfo has information about how the resource is configured for Backup and about the most recent backup to this vault.

Inheritance

object > BackupConfigInfo

Namespace

Google.Cloud.BackupDR.V1

Assembly

Google.Cloud.BackupDR.V1.dll

Constructors

BackupConfigInfo()

public BackupConfigInfo()

BackupConfigInfo(BackupConfigInfo)

public BackupConfigInfo(BackupConfigInfo other)
Parameter
Name Description
other BackupConfigInfo

Properties

BackupApplianceBackupConfig

public BackupApplianceBackupConfig BackupApplianceBackupConfig { get; set; }

Configuration for an application backed up by a Backup Appliance.

Property Value
Type Description
BackupApplianceBackupConfig

BackupConfigCase

public BackupConfigInfo.BackupConfigOneofCase BackupConfigCase { get; }
Property Value
Type Description
BackupConfigInfoBackupConfigOneofCase

GcpBackupConfig

public GcpBackupConfig GcpBackupConfig { get; set; }

Configuration for a Google Cloud resource.

Property Value
Type Description
GcpBackupConfig

LastBackupError

public Status LastBackupError { get; set; }

Output only. If the last backup failed, this field has the error message.

Property Value
Type Description
Status

LastBackupState

public BackupConfigInfo.Types.LastBackupState LastBackupState { get; set; }

Output only. The status of the last backup to this BackupVault

Property Value
Type Description
BackupConfigInfoTypesLastBackupState

LastSuccessfulBackupConsistencyTime

public Timestamp LastSuccessfulBackupConsistencyTime { get; set; }

Output only. If the last backup were successful, this field has the consistency date.

Property Value
Type Description
Timestamp